📜  DBMS中分类和聚类的区别(1)

📅  最后修改于: 2023-12-03 15:14:38.429000             🧑  作者: Mango

DBMS中分类和聚类的区别

在一个数据库管理系统中,分类和聚类都是为了帮助我们更好地管理和组织数据,但是两者之间是有明显的差异的。下面我们来对这两者进行对比和解释。

分类

分类是一种数据的组织方式,它将数据按照一定规则分成若干类别,使得每一类别中的数据都具有相同的特征。分类可以进行多级,将数据分成大类,小类,子类等等。分类的目的是为了在查询数据的时候更加方便快捷,能够更好地区分和归纳数据。

例如,在一个图书管理系统中,我们可以将所有的类别分为小说、散文、历史、科技等等,这样可以更方便地浏览、查询和管理书籍。

聚类

聚类也是一种数据的组织方式,但不同于分类,聚类是根据数据的相似性把它们组合起来,形成一些新的组或者簇。聚类的目的是为了在寻找数据之间的关系和模式时更加方便快捷,能够更好地对数据进行集中处理。

例如,在一个销售数据的数据库中,我们可以通过聚类来找出哪些用户购买了相似的产品或者在相同的时间内进行了购买,这样可以更好地预测销售趋势和推荐相关产品。

区别
  • 分类是根据一定规则将数据进行分组,是一种已知类别的过程,而聚类是根据数据的相似性将数据进行归类,是一种未知类别的过程。

  • 分类的对象是具有相同特征的数据,而聚类的对象是相似的数据。

  • 分类的结果可以提高数据组织和查询的效率,而聚类的结果可以帮助我们探索数据之间的关系和模式。

综上所述,分类和聚类是两种不同的数据组织方式,各有其独特的优点和用途。有了对它们的了解,我们可以更好地管理和利用数据,为程序的开发和数据分析提供更多的有用信息。